Who we are and what we do

Foundation Gaudium is a Non-profit Organization devoted since 1997 to the study of non-chemical addictions, with main focus on addictions to new technologies and safer use of the Internet, mobile phones and videogames and pathological gambling, including online gaming.
Foundation Gaudium main activities are scientific meetings, research projects, epidemiological studies, publications, awareness raising activities, preventive programs, helplines for affected people and training of experts.

Safer Internet and Prevention of Addictions among adolescents

Gaudium Foundation promotes research and develops preventive programs, awareness raising activities for a safer use of the Internet and treatment of addiction to new technologies studying its causes and consequences, treatment techniques, training of specialists and design and implementation of preventive measures, especially addressing children and adolescents at risk. Materials such as guides for parents and teachers have been produced and are available both online and offline.
Five years ago Gaudium Foundation started a leading program in Spain aiming to prevent the healthy and safer use of Internet, mobile phones and videogames among minors and their families. This program, financed by the Regional Government of Madrid, is being implemented in Primary Education Schools and has reached 36.000 children and parents. Since then, the Foundation's activities have expanded all over Spain. Our experts are invited to give lectures and workshops in schools and comunities addressing children, parents, teachers and other proffessionals woking in this field.
The foundation provides a HELP LINE available for children and families affected by the risks of online activities, such as cyberbullying, harmful contents and ilicit conducts. This conselling is provided by psychologists and lawyers in collaboration with the Clinical Unit of the Psychology Masters Degree of the Psychology Faculty at the University Complutense of Madrid.
Besides conferences and scientific meetings, our foundation ellaborates every year a publication with the most recent research and developments in this field.
